Key points include: India is the world's largest milk producer and the second-largest egg producer.. The livestock sector grew at a CAGR of 7.38% from 2014-15 to 2022-23.. Livestock's share in agriculture GVA increased from 24.32% to 30.98% in the same period.. Understanding this topic is essential for both UPSC Prelims and Mains preparation.

The Basic Animal Husbandry Statistics (BAHS) 2024 report provides a comprehensive overview of the performance of India's vital animal husbandry sector. It highlights significant growth across various sub-sectors, reinforcing their contribution to the national economy.
India continues to maintain its position as the largest producer of milk globally. The sector demonstrated robust growth in the latest reporting period.

The broader livestock sector has demonstrated impressive sustained growth over nearly a decade, significantly increasing its share in agricultural output.
This increasing share highlights the sector's growing importance to the overall agricultural Gross Value Added (GVA). Furthermore, the 21st Livestock Census is currently underway, promising updated and comprehensive data for future planning and policy formulation.
